STI/Hoopfeed Poll for 3/10/20: Upsets galore, Maryland moves up to No. 4

With a week of conference tournaments in the rearview and some surprising upsets, this week’s poll features a shakeup in the top ten. However, the No. 1 team in the land, South Carolina, continues to hold steady in the top spot after beating No. 9 Mississippi State in the SEC Tournament championship on Sunday.

Oregon moved up a place to No. 2 after topping No. 8 Stanford in the Pac-12 championship title game Sunday night. One of the week’s most stunning upsets: No. 3 Baylor had its 58-game Big 12 win streak snapped by unranked Iowa State in the last regular-season game for both teams. The Lady Bears fell one place after the loss.

Maryland moved up a spot to No. 4 after beating Ohio State and winning the Big Ten tournament crown. UConn rounds out the top five as the Huskies earned their seventh-straight American Athletic Conference tournament title, beating Cincinnati and finishing their last year in the league, before moving to the Big East next season, with a 139-0 conference record.

Another unexpected defeat was Gonzaga’s loss in the semifinals of the West Coast Conference tournament to unranked Portland. The Pilots went on to win the tournament with an overtime win against San Diego. With the loss, Gonzaga dropped two places in the poll to No. 14.

Heading into the second week of conference tournaments, teams that secured an auto-bid with a league championship include UConn, Maryland, Dayton, DePaul, Maryland, IUPUI, Princeton, Oregon, South Carolina, Samford, South Dakota, Portland. Keep tabs on the tourney schedule and winners here.

No teams dropped out of the poll. Other teams that received votes: FGCU, TCU, Ohio State, Marquette, and Rutgers.

Rank School Record Last Change
1 South Carolina 32-1 1 0
2 Oregon 31-2 3 1
3 Baylor 28-2 2 -1
4 Maryland 28-4 5 1
5 UConn 29-3 6 1
6 Louisville 28-4 4 -2
7 NC State 28-4 11 4
8 Stanford 27-6 7 -1
9 Mississippi State 27-6 9 0
10 UCLA 26-5 8 -2
11 Northwestern 26-4 10 -1
12 Arizona 24-7 13 1
13 Oregon State 23-9 14 1
14 Gonzaga 28-3 12 -2
15 DePaul 28-5 19 4
16 South Dakota 30-2 15 -1
17 Kentucky 22-8 17 0
18 Florida State 24-8 22 4
19 Texas A&M 22-8 16 -3
20 Indiana 24-8 20 0
21 Iowa 23-7 18 -3
22 Princeton 26-1 21 -1
23 Missouri State 26-4 23 0
24 Arkansas 24-8 25 1
25 Arizona State 20-11 24 -1

The STI/Hoopfeed Poll is conducted weekly throughout the regular season using a panel of media members and other women’s basketball professionals.
